#1f993e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1f993e is composed of 12.2% red, 60%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 59.5%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 135.2 degrees, a saturation of 66.3% and a lightness of 36.1%. #1f993e color hex could be obtained by blending #3eff7c with #003300.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

#1f993e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1f993e has RGB values of R:31, G:153, B:62 and CMYK values of C:0.8, M:0, Y:0.59,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 2070846.

Shades and Tints of #1f993e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010603 is the darkest color, while #f5fdf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#1f993e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#58605a is the less saturated color, while #03b530 is the most saturated one.
